Logging

Database Migration Service menggunakan Cloud Logging. Anda dapat mengakses dua kategori log untuk mendapatkan informasi mendetail tentang peristiwa yang terjadi terkait dengan tugas migrasi Anda: log Database Migration Service, dan log Cloud SQL untuk PostgreSQL tujuan.

Log Database Migration Service

Database Migration Service untuk Oracle ke Cloud SQL untuk PostgreSQL menyediakan log terstruktur untuk resource datamigration.googleapis.com/MigrationJob, datamigration.googleapis.com/ConnectionProfile, dan datamigration.googleapis.com/PrivateConnection. Log ini mewakili peristiwa dunia nyata, seperti saat tugas migrasi dibuat, saat Database Migration Service membaca informasi dari database sumber Anda, atau saat profil koneksi diedit.

Setiap entri log berisi kolom jsonPayload.textMessage dengan deskripsi untuk membantu Anda lebih memahami peristiwa tersebut. Ada berbagai jenis pesan, misalnya:

Contoh pesan log untuk resource datamigration.googleapis.com/MigrationJob
Log pesan teks Deskripsi
FULL DUMP read is completed for table: {SCHEMA_TABLE_NAME} Pesan ini berarti Database Migration Service telah selesai membaca data tabel tertentu di database sumber untuk fase dump penuh. Pesan ini menunjukkan bahwa fase dump lengkap untuk tabel berada dalam tahap lanjutan dan kemungkinan akan segera selesai.
Successfully loaded {NUMBER} FULL DUMP rows into table: {SCHEMA_TABLE_NAME} Pesan ini berarti bahwa Database Migration Service telah selesai menulis batch baris ke dalam tabel tertentu di instance tujuan Anda selama fase dump penuh.
Successfully applied {NUMBER} CDC rows into table: {SCHEMA_TABLE_NAME} Pesan ini berarti Database Migration Service telah selesai menulis batch baris ke dalam tabel tertentu di instance tujuan Anda selama fase CDC.
Accessing data of table: {SCHEMA_TABLE_NAME} for data processing purpose Saat Anda menggunakan CMEK untuk tugas migrasi, pesan ini menunjukkan bahwa Database Migration Service mengakses kunci enkripsi untuk memproses data untuk tabel tertentu.

Log instance Cloud SQL untuk PostgreSQL

Cloud SQL untuk PostgreSQL juga menyediakan entri log untuk instance tujuan Anda. Lihat Referensi log Cloud SQL di dokumentasi Cloud Logging.

Melihat dan membuat kueri log

Untuk melihat log Anda, lakukan hal berikut:

  1. Di konsol Google Cloud , buka halaman Migration jobs.

    Buka Tugas migrasi

  2. Di tab Tugas, klik nama tampilan tugas migrasi yang lognya ingin Anda lihat.

    Halaman detail tugas migrasi akan terbuka.

  3. Di halaman detail tugas migrasi, klik Lihat log dan lakukan salah satu tindakan berikut:
    • Untuk melihat log tugas migrasi, pilih Migration job logs.
    • Untuk melihat log untuk instance tujuan Cloud SQL untuk PostgreSQL Anda, pilih Log instance tujuan.

    Halaman Logs Explorer akan terbuka.

  4. Di halaman Logs Explorer, Anda dapat menggunakan menu drop-down untuk mengubah kueri dan memfilter entri log. Misalnya, untuk memfilter log tugas migrasi untuk peristiwa saat Database Migration Service mengakses tabel tertentu di database sumber Anda, Anda dapat menggunakan kueri yang mirip dengan berikut ini:
    resource.type="datamigration.googleapis.com/MigrationJob"
    resource.labels.migration_job_id="MIGRATION_JOB_ID"
    jsonPayload.textMessage:"Accessing data of table"

Langkah berikutnya